diff options
author | Milla Pohjanheimo <milla.pohjanheimo@qt.io> | 2016-09-27 10:50:28 +0300 |
---|---|---|
committer | Yoann Lopes <yoann.lopes@qt.io> | 2016-09-27 08:03:18 +0000 |
commit | c4bf444f5cf71518fb52bc4f19515a9a662a107d (patch) | |
tree | f1bbdc6bad6753c79072a02fc0c58ba63275c014 /tests | |
parent | 9d9a29bcc31101e394ea484f61985cac75524ba1 (diff) | |
download | qtmultimedia-c4bf444f5cf71518fb52bc4f19515a9a662a107d.tar.gz |
Stabilize pushSuspendResume() autotest
Same as 7d00a457e455e159a3dde30ad798be744cf38bb1.
Change-Id: Ia7b01eef7650c1db23562d1a36a4a19748c92fc7
Reviewed-by: Yoann Lopes <yoann.lopes@qt.io>
Diffstat (limited to 'tests')
-rw-r--r-- | tests/auto/integration/qaudiooutput/tst_qaudiooutput.cpp |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/tests/auto/integration/qaudiooutput/tst_qaudiooutput.cpp b/tests/auto/integration/qaudiooutput/tst_qaudiooutput.cpp index e36d38f4a..8990590ee 100644 --- a/tests/auto/integration/qaudiooutput/tst_qaudiooutput.cpp +++ b/tests/auto/integration/qaudiooutput/tst_qaudiooutput.cpp @@ -844,8 +844,8 @@ void tst_QAudioOutput::pushSuspendResume() QTest::qWait(1000); // 1 seconds should be plenty QVERIFY2(audioFile->atEnd(), "didn't play to EOF"); - QVERIFY2((stateSignal.count() == 1), - QString("didn't emit IdleState signal when at EOF, got %1 signals instead").arg(stateSignal.count()).toLocal8Bit().constData()); + QVERIFY(stateSignal.count() > 0); + QCOMPARE(qvariant_cast<QAudio::State>(stateSignal.last().at(0)), QAudio::IdleState); QVERIFY2((audioOutput.state() == QAudio::IdleState), "didn't transitions to IdleState when at EOF"); stateSignal.clear(); |